In this episode of Ronversations, Ron Ross sits down with multi-platinum artist Michael "Fitz" Fitzpatrick of Fitz and the Tantrums ahead of their upcoming show at Hollywood Casino at Charles Town Races.

Fitz talks about life on the road, the powerful connection between music and fans, and the unforgettable moment he first heard a crowd singing his songs back to him. He also shares the story behind how Fitz and the Tantrums came together, the creative freedom that shaped their latest album Man on the Moon, and how today's music landscape, from streaming to social media, has changed the way artists create hits.

Plus, stick around for Ron's "Five Fast Facts" segment, where Fitz reveals his favorite road food, a surprising hidden talent, what he's listening to right now, and the very first song he ever performed in public.
